发生背景项目里想用 ts-node 跑个脚本,执行:代码是 TypeScript + ES Module (真香),于是 ts-node 开始抱怨:解决方案在 tsconfig.json 中添加 "ts-node": { "...
-
node.js typescript ecmascript ts-node 报错 ERR
-
前端 typescript 阿里低代码引擎使用 - 项目启动 & 本地物料开发
最近开始折腾低代码平台,用了阿里的低代码框架。整体体验还行,但是坑也不少,特别是物料描述这一块,官方文档虽然不少内容,但是一些小东西还是缺了不少。所以想把整个过程记录下来分享给大家。我打算是利用这个引擎做一个比较全面的定制化...
-
vue.js javascript 搭配 TypeScript 使用 Vue
...
-
ide javascript typescript vite vue3 ts import.meta在vscode中报错
问题描述:开发使用的框架为vite+vue3+ts,在开发过程中莫名其妙报仅当“--module”选项为“es2020”、“esnext”或“系统”时才允许使用“import.meta”元属性问题解决:通过更改tsconfi...
-
javascript 前端 TypeScript 最近各版本主要特性总结
(在人生的道路上,当你的期望一个个落空的时候,你也要坚定,要沉着。——朗费罗)官网 在线运行TypeScript代码 第三方中文博客特性typescript是javascript的超集,向javascript继承额外的编辑器...
-
typescript javascript 前端 基于CODESYS平台运用ANY数据类型,获取任意变量属性
什么编程场景会用到ANY数据类型? 用在功能Function上,外部输入数据的数据类型有多种可能性,但又要功能Function兼容,这时候ANY就会用上,如下面所示。 在功能Function中...
-
javascript Cocos Creator 之 typescript几种常见的设计模式
文章目录前言模式设计单例模式代理模式观察者模式工厂模式前言提示:以下是本篇文章正文内容,下面案例可供参考模式设计单例模式// 构造方法私有 防止new代理模式观察者模式// 发生变化// 遍历观察者数组 给所有观察者发消息c...
-
javascript 前端 TypeScript初学
文章转载:https://blog.csdn.net/weixin_46185369/article/details/121512287写的很详细,适合初学者看看。一、TypeScript是什么?1.TypeScript简称...
-
javascript 前端 typescript 函数重载
typescript 函数重载1,介绍2,2种写法2.1,写法1:函数声明和函数实现分离2.2,写法2:使用函数表达式和函数类型注解3,示例1,介绍在 TypeScript 中,函数重载(Function Overloadi...
-
vue.js 前端 javascript typescript git Vue项目配置文件(.npmrc、.env、. cz-config.js、commitlint.config.js)
一、.npmrc .npmrc 文件位于项目的根目录(即 node_modules 和 package.json 的兄弟),作为npm运行时的配置文件。registry为npm包注册源地址,legacy-peer-deps忽...
-
javascript TS TypeScript详细总结归纳!!!
一、前言学完一个东西,总要总结一下才能巩固,好记性不如烂笔头。本文想对TypeScript进行详细的基础知识总结,若有错误之处还请指正。另外本文中的示例可直接在 playground 上运行。使用的TypeScript版本:...
-
前端 javascript typescript vue.js fetch发送请求:Failed to fetch
背景使用 fetch 下载图片,出现跨域问题, 如下图。查看错误信息,需要设置mode为 no-cors下载流文件详细内容// 使用获取到的blob对象创建的url// 指定下载的文件名// 移除blob对象的url...
-
javascript TypeScript笔记
稀土掘金-typescript史上最强学习入门文章(2w字 typescript史上最强学习入门文章(2w字 文章目录1-搭建typescript学习环境编译选项基础数据类型JS的八种内置类型注意点nulll 和 undef...
-
【TypeScript教程】# 5:TS编译选项
说明尚硅谷TypeScript教程(李立超老师TS新课)学习笔记。自动编译文件编译文件时,使用 -w 指令后,TS编译器会自动监视文件的变化,并在文件发生变化时对文件进行重新编译。自动编译整个项目如果直接使用 tsc 指令,...
-
uni-app javascript 前端 vue.js typescript uniapp vue3+ts H5 省市区选择器组件
...
-
前端 javascript typescript html react.js Rxjs源码解析(一)Observable
学习一个库最好的方法就是看其源码,理解其 api 的调用原理,用起来自然也就很清楚自己到底在干什么了,秉持着此观念,为了更好地理解 rxjs,抽空将其源码看了一遍本系列文章不会刻意涉及概念性的东西,主线就是解读源码,并在恰当...
-
html5 typescript angular 将数组分割成多个固定长度的数组
数组分割成多个数组后即可在轮播图中分数组渲染数据目录前言使用步骤1.封装一个函数,使用slice方法2.结果展示3.渲染数据前言在angular项目移动端的制作时,遇到了使用ionic组件库中的slides轮播图,而此时后端...
-
javascript 前端 【经典】请求拦截,相应拦截vue3封装,使用dom封装typescript接口
目录第一部分:封装请求及响应拦截第二部分:使用dom封装typescript接口...
-
javascript 前端 TypeScript语法
TypeScript基础语法1.1 js与ts的区别最大区别:js不会在赋值时检查是否与类型匹配,而ts会检查所赋的值是否与类型匹配,若不匹配则会进行报错提示1.2 js的数据类型(两大类)1.2.1 原始数据类型(5种)原...
-
前端 开发语言 typescript 在函数中声明回调函数
简单记录下,在学习使用 typescript 的过程中,在语法检查的时候遇到了这样的提示:大概的意思就是说:不要使用 Function 类型作为参数的类型,因为一些函数的返回是不安全的,不知道函数会返回什么内容我一开始是这样...
-
cocos2d 游戏程序 typescript 游戏引擎 【CocosCreator入门】CocosCreator组件 | PageView(页面视图)组件
Cocos Creator 是一款流行的游戏开发引擎,具有丰富的组件和工具,其中的PageView组件是一种用于实现分页视图效果的重要组件。它可以让我们在游戏中实现各种分页视图效果,例如引导页、轮播图等。目录一...
-
前端 开发语言 typescript ts进阶高级笔记 <小满zs版本 yyds>
类型兼容:typeScript中的类型兼容性是基于结构类型的(也就是形状),如果A要兼容B 那么A至少具有B相同的属性协变 逆变 双协变协变也可以叫鸭子类型// 主类型// 子类型name: '老墨',name: '老高',...
-
javascript 前端 动态加载图片 Vue3+TypeScript+Vite如何使用require动态引入类似于图片等静态资源
问题:Vue3+TypeScript+Vite的项目中如何使用require动态引入类似于图片等静态资源!描述:今天在开发项目时(项目框架为Vue3+TypeScript+Vite)需要 动态引入静态资源,也就是img标签的...
-
typescript TS-namespace(命名空间)
在ts中,namespace(命名空间)相当于闭包,可以隔绝作用域,格式如下:namespace X {}1. 原因 在我们使用某个命名空间里的东西的时候,往往会比较麻烦,比如以下代码:果我们要使用里头的Triangle或者...
-
javascript 前端 TypeScript 中的 type 关键字有什么用?
创建类型别名在 TypeScript 中,type 关键字用于创建类型别名(Type Alias)。类型别名可以给一个类型起一个新的名字,使代码更具可读性和可维护性。类型别名可以用于定义各种类型,包括基本类型、复合类型和自定...
-
javascript vue.js typescript 前端 vue3+TS实战中Dialog弹窗封装复用技巧(修改和添加共用一个弹窗)涉及组件的传值(defineProps)和组件的自定义事件(emits)
vue3+TS实战中Dialog弹窗封装复用技巧前言业务要求封装步骤1.Dialog组件的UI部分实现2.组件传值和自定义事件编辑功能添加功能和自定义事件3.不同功能进行不同的api地址请求最后前言Dialog弹窗在后台管理...
-
vue.js 前端 vue(typescript)项目在vs中打开出现的各种问题
问题一:TS2792 (TS 找不到模块“xxx”。你的意思是要将 "moduleResolution" 选项设置为 "node",还是要将别名添加到 "paths" 选项中? TS6046 (TS “-...
-
前端 javascript 【TypeScript】TS进阶-泛型(八)
🐱个人主页:不叫猫先生 🙋♂️作者简介:前端领域新星创作者、阿里云专家博主,专注于前端各领域技术,共同学习共同进步,一起加油呀! 💫系列专栏:vue3从入门到精通、TypeScript从入门到实践 📢资料领取:前端进阶资料...
-
vue.js typescript 参数“item”隐式具有“any”类型。ts(7006)
文章目录bug 复现解决方法bug 复现可以看到实际数组是有内容的,但还是 7006解决方法1 加类型可以看到加了类型就没有提示了2 修改配置参数 找到 tsconfig.json 文件将 strict 字段改为 false...
-
vue.js 前端 typescript 找不到模块“./App.vue”或其相应的类型声明
在vue3中将js文件转为ts文件会报下面的错误解决方法 在根目录下新建env.d.ts文件(和src同级) 输入下面这行代码报错原因 未定义 .vue文件 的类型, 导致 ts 无法解析其类型,在env.d.ts中定义后方...
-
前端 typescript vue3 v-for遍历defineProps或者props接收的数据时,报“xx” is of type ‘unknown‘
...
-
大屏适配 小白系列Vite-Vue3-TypeScript:009-屏幕适配
上一篇我们介绍了Vite+Vue3+TypeScript项目中mockjs的安装和配置。本篇我们来介绍屏幕适配方案,简单说来就是要最大程度上保证我们的界面在各种各样的终端设备上显示正常。通用的屏幕适配方案有两种:① 基于re...
-
javascript 前端 开发语言 ecmascript typescript 记录--用JS轻松实现一个录音、录像、录屏的工具库
这里给大家分享我在网上总结出来的一些知识,希望对大家有所帮助前言最近项目遇到一个要在网页上录音的需求,在一波搜索后,发现了 react-media-recorder 这个库。今天就跟大家一起研究一下这个库的源码吧,从 0 到...
-
javascript 发布typescript的npm的多模块包
最近在写一些本地小脚本,辅助开发,从纯js过渡到了ts,记录一下。没有使用一个npm包工具,纯单撸。1.安装ts环境//如果安装全局模块2.新建个文件夹,点住shift+鼠标右键,点击打开Powershell的窗口,输入来创...
-
spring cloud typescript 计算机毕设之 基于协同过滤的考研推荐系统
1 简介今天向大家介绍一个帮助往届学生完成的毕业设计项目,基于协同过滤的考研推荐系统。计算机毕业生设计,课程设计需要帮助的可以找我2 设计概要21世纪是信息化时代,随着信息技术和网络技术的发展,信息化已经渗透到人们日常生活的...
-
vue.js javascript Vue项目构建vue项目Typescript配置文件出现错误
配置文件报错tsconfig.node.json文件提示错误: “Path to base configuration file to inherit from (requires TypeScript version 2....
-
typescript vscode javascript 前端 node.js 第一章:初识 TS
初识 TS前言一、 认识 TS二、 安装 TS三、 第一个 TS 文件1. 创建文件2. tsc 编译3. 编译完成题外话前言本系列主要讲解 TypeScript 的使用,文章中会用 TS 代替 TypeScript。在技术...
-
javascript 前端 Typescript 中的 interface 和 type 有什么区别?
总结:type 后面有 =,interface 没有。type 可以描述任何类型组合,interface 只能描述对象结构。interface 可以继承自(extends)interface 或对象结构的 type。type...
-
前端 2023 我的兔年flag 【TypeScript】TS进阶-函数重载(七)
🐱个人主页:不叫猫先生 🙋♂️作者简介:前端领域新星创作者、阿里云专家博主,专注于前端各领域技术,共同学习共同进步,一起加油呀! 💫系列专栏:vue3从入门到精通、TypeScript从入门到实践 📢资料领取:前端进阶资料...
-
javascript vue.js typescript vue3+ts+vite 路径别名配置
找vite.config.js.ts文件,进行配置.路径别名如果是单个的话,alias后面写对象,多个的话写数组,里面再放对象.base:'./', //设置打包路径如果使用typeScript编写的,还需要修改typeS...
-
javascript vue.js typescript ts语法定义对象类型引用报错
ts定义了对象,使用对象里的属性时,用'.'的方式会报错。有两个解决方案:1.声明类型为any,报错即解决,但这失去了ts的意义。2.使用对象里的属性时用中括号加引号的写法:例如://定义一个对象//监视属性使用时@Watc...
-
javascript 前端 typescript vue3+ts+vite+cesium 加载天地图影像、标注等多服务器随机加载切换版本
...
-
react.js javascript typescript create-react-app中配置less与别名alias(使用craco)
文章目录前言1.初始化项目2.安装craco和craco-less3.配置craco.config.js4.创建tsconfig-base.json5.修改tsconfig.json6.修改react-app-env.d.t...
-
vue.js 前端 typescript javascript 在项目中使用TS封装 axios,一次封装永久使用
🍳作者: 贤蛋大眼萌,一名很普通但不想普通的程序媛 \color{#FF0000}{贤蛋 大眼萌 ,一名很普通但不想普通的程序媛} 贤蛋大眼萌,一名很普通但不想普通的程序媛🤳🙊语录: 多一些不为什么的坚持 \color{#0...
-
vue 态势标绘 Cesium typescript 标绘编辑 DEJA
前言编写这个专栏主要目的是对工作之中基于Cesium实现过的功能进行整合,有自己琢磨实现的,也有参考其他大神后整理实现的,初步算了算现在有差不多实现小140个左右的功能,后续也会不断的追加,所以暂时打算一周2-3更的样子来更...
-
javascript 前端 TypeScript教程(四)基本运算符
一、运算符TypeScript包含以下几种运算符:1.算术运算符2.逻辑运算符3.关系运算符4.按位运算符5.赋值运算符6.三元/条件运算符7.字符串运算符8.类型运算符1.算术运算符运算符描述例子x 运算结果y 运算结果+...
-
javascript node.js 前端 es6 TypeScript由浅到深(上篇)
目录一、什么是TypeScript有什么特点:二、TypeScript的编译环境:三、TypeScript数据类型:01_标识符的类型推导:02_JS中的类型Array:03_JS 中的类型Object:04_函数的类型:0...
-
前端 typescript 【HarmonyOS应用开发】ArkTS开发实践(四)
文章最后附上 案例代码下载地址一、声明式UI基本概念应用界面是由一个个页面组成,ArkTS是由ArkUI框架提供,用于以声明式开发范式开发界面的语言。声明式UI构建页面的过程,其实是组合组件的过程,声明式UI的思想,主要体现...
-
typescript vue3+vite的axios的封装与全局使用
1.安装axios使用npm 或 yarn 安装axios到项目中// 使用pnpm 安装 pnpm install axios// 使用npm 安装 npm install axios// 使用yarn 安装 y...
-
okhttp 前端 javascript typescript Ajax与Promise
...